Practical care record
Use this checklist when creating or reviewing each cat’s care plan.
Record primary and emergency veterinarians, diagnoses, medications, allergies, pharmacy details, preventive care, mobility, dental needs, and monitoring schedules.
Record food, feeding times, litter type and location, sleep, play, hiding places, social relationships, handling preferences, triggers, calming methods, and household rules.
Include current photos, microchip details, physical identifiers, carrier location, transport needs, emergency contacts, and end-of-life preferences subject to veterinary judgment and applicable law.
